thats kind of a judgement call in my opinion. with ebay you run the typical risks of getting a sub-par product and paying out the butt to ship it back and get a new one, granted the seller will even let you. but if it works out well, you saved some cash. if you go to a local place, then youre gonna pay more, probably save the shipping charges and have an actual face-to-face person you can go back and deal with if the brush guard is crap, thus usually resulting in a better chance of getting the product replaced or getting a refund. its your call wether or not its worth the risk.

He can't get one. I don't think ARB makes a bumper for 96-99 R50's. Only 87-95 & 99.5-2004.TJM use to make a bumper for the 96-99 R50 though.
